summaryrefslogtreecommitdiffstats
path: root/conf/machine/imx8mp-lpddr4-evk.conf
diff options
context:
space:
mode:
authorTom Hochstein <tom.hochstein@nxp.com>2021-03-29 11:50:24 -0500
committerOtavio Salvador <otavio@ossystems.com.br>2021-03-30 08:55:00 -0300
commit823a97cf01828c6f3696b0b5be7d4feaa755cb59 (patch)
tree8a128739e0016d987ce30446c46d4723d6c6af44 /conf/machine/imx8mp-lpddr4-evk.conf
parent02eb3ffd5ac527f5e8f360b26dba1cd6faee4dff (diff)
downloadmeta-freescale-823a97cf01828c6f3696b0b5be7d4feaa755cb59.tar.gz
imx8mp-lpddr4-evk: Rework 8M Plus EVK config file
There are two variants of the 8M Plus Evaluation Kit board, one with LPDDR4 and one with DDR4. Rework our existing config file to make this distinction explicit in the machine config file name and to allow for configuration re-use. Signed-off-by: Tom Hochstein <tom.hochstein@nxp.com>
Diffstat (limited to 'conf/machine/imx8mp-lpddr4-evk.conf')
-rw-r--r--conf/machine/imx8mp-lpddr4-evk.conf47
1 files changed, 47 insertions, 0 deletions
diff --git a/conf/machine/imx8mp-lpddr4-evk.conf b/conf/machine/imx8mp-lpddr4-evk.conf
new file mode 100644
index 00000000..6484da7c
--- /dev/null
+++ b/conf/machine/imx8mp-lpddr4-evk.conf
@@ -0,0 +1,47 @@
1#@TYPE: Machine
2#@NAME: NXP i.MX 8M Plus EVK with LPDDR4
3#@SOC: i.MX8MP
4#@DESCRIPTION: Machine configuration for NXP i.MX 8M Plus Evaluation Kit with LPDDR4
5#@MAINTAINER: Jun Zhu <junzhu@nxp.com>
6
7require include/imx8mp-evk.inc
8
9# The device tree name is implicit for LPDDR4, so can't use MACHINE here
10KERNEL_DEVICETREE_BASENAME = "imx8mp-evk"
11
12# NXP kernel has additional DTB files for various board configuration and
13# derivates. Include them here for NXP BSP only
14KERNEL_DEVICETREE_append_use-nxp-bsp = " \
15 freescale/imx8mp-ab2.dtb \
16 freescale/imx8mp-evk-basler.dtb \
17 freescale/imx8mp-evk-basler-ov5640.dtb \
18 freescale/imx8mp-evk-dsp.dtb \
19 freescale/imx8mp-evk-dsp-lpa.dtb \
20 freescale/imx8mp-evk-dual-ov2775.dtb \
21 freescale/imx8mp-evk-flexcan2.dtb \
22 freescale/imx8mp-evk-inmate.dtb \
23 freescale/imx8mp-evk-it6263-lvds-dual-channel.dtb \
24 freescale/imx8mp-evk-jdi-wuxga-lvds-panel.dtb \
25 freescale/imx8mp-evk-ov2775.dtb \
26 freescale/imx8mp-evk-ov2775-ov5640.dtb \
27 freescale/imx8mp-evk-pcie-ep.dtb \
28 freescale/imx8mp-evk-rm67191.dtb \
29 freescale/imx8mp-evk-root.dtb \
30 freescale/imx8mp-evk-rpmsg.dtb \
31 freescale/imx8mp-evk-sof-wm8960.dtb \
32 freescale/imx8mp-evk-spdif-lb.dtb \
33"
34
35UBOOT_CONFIG_BASENAME = "imx8mp_evk"
36UBOOT_CONFIG[fspi] = "${UBOOT_CONFIG_BASENAME}_defconfig"
37
38# Set DDR FIRMWARE
39DDR_FIRMWARE_VERSION = "202006"
40DDR_FIRMWARE_NAME = " \
41 lpddr4_pmu_train_1d_dmem_${DDR_FIRMWARE_VERSION}.bin \
42 lpddr4_pmu_train_1d_imem_${DDR_FIRMWARE_VERSION}.bin \
43 lpddr4_pmu_train_2d_dmem_${DDR_FIRMWARE_VERSION}.bin \
44 lpddr4_pmu_train_2d_imem_${DDR_FIRMWARE_VERSION}.bin \
45"
46
47IMXBOOT_TARGETS_BASENAME = "flash_evk"